  "account": "The International Facilities Management Conference is highlighting the role of artificial intelligence within the sector, according to Eng. Ayed Al-Qahtani, the chief of the Saudi Facilities Management Association. Speaking to Al Ekhbariya TV, Al-Qahtani emphasized that the conference serves as a platform for asset owners and service providers from both public and private sectors to investigate opportunities and enhance cooperation locally and globally through dialogue between the two parties. A diverse group of participants, including representatives from various ministries, government agencies, centers, and municipalities, as well as providers of comprehensive facilities management services and technical solutions, is expected to attend. The event will also feature presentations from a select group of speakers with extensive expertise and academic backgrounds.",
